Learn Today to the Future Live -YuVAL Noah Harari

  Reinvent Themselves . That's Nobody Knows, how the world look like in 2050, except it will be different from today . So the most important things to emphasize in education are things like  EI (Emotional Intelligence),  and MENTAL stability.  Because the one things, that they will need for sure, is the ability to reinvent themselves repeatedly, throughout their lives. It's really the first time in history, that we don't fully know, what particular skills to teach young people. Because we just don't know in what kind of world they will be living. But we do know, the will have to reinvent themselves.
